Understanding the Process
- Input: Electronic waste (e-waste) and other industrial waste
- Process: The waste is subjected to a series of chemical and physical processes to extract valuable minerals such as lithium, cobalt, and rare earth metals.
- Output: Critical minerals and a significant reduction in waste volume
